Frequently Asked Questions about Richmond Heights

How much are Studio apartments in Richmond Heights?

There are currently 124 Studio Apartments in Richmond Heights with rent ranges from $1,100 to $2,229 with an average price of $1,533.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Richmond Heights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Richmond Heights ranges from $550 to $3,542 with an average monthly rent of $1,854.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Richmond Heights c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Richmond Heights range from $669 to $5,584.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,126.

How expensive are Richmond Heights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 120 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Richmond Heights on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$687 to $5,798 - averaging $1,930 for the location.
